What is Core Molding Technologies's operating income?
Core Molding Technologies (CMT) reported operating income of $764K in Q1 2026.
How has Core Molding Technologies's operating income changed year-over-year?
Core Molding Technologies's operating income decreased by 73.1% year-over-year, from $2.84M to $764K.
What is the long-term trend for Core Molding Technologies's operating income?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Core Molding Technologies's operating income has grown at a 6.5%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$11.07M to $14.22M.
What does operating income mean?
Gross profit minus all operating expenses (SG&A, R&D, D&A). Measures the profit from core business operations before interest, taxes, and non-operating items.
